Using unauthorized aids to complete quizzes or exams is a form of cheating. Educational institutions and professional certification bodies treat this seriously; violations can lead to sanctions, loss of certification, and damage to one’s professional reputation. In fact, many platforms explicitly prohibit the posting or sharing of quiz answers as a violation of their honor codes.

Platforms like Quizlet, Chegg, or Brainly sometimes feature flashcards or study guides uploaded by students who previously took similar courses. While these can be incredibly helpful for studying, relying on them during a live quiz is risky. User-submitted answers are frequently unverified and contain errors that can tank your score.
